Default Wheel Locks

For anyone who is in the market for wheel locks, the part number for McGard locks 24157 will not properly seat for the F Sport Wheels. Checked with amazon and they list same part number. Talked to parts department with my Lexus dealer and they stated it would not fit. Stated they could get the correct set for me, but recommended they not be used. They stated too many people misplace the key and that some tire shops using pneumatic tools strip the locking mechanism on the nut itself.
